rlDhcpClEnabledByDefaultRemovedIfindex

Dell-VRTX-DHCPCL-MIB · .1.3.6.1.4.1.89.76.16

Object

scalar r/w Integer32
DHCP Client flag is relevant when host parameter dhcp_client_active_on_start is TRUE.
If the MIB has non zero value the meaning is that DHCP client has removed from configuration by the user
on the interface and signs to application not to add DHCP client entry. Otherwise (zero value) - the meaning is
that DHCP client entry must be added.
